#6B8EEC Hex Color Code

#6B8EEC

The Hexadecimal Color #6B8EEC is a contrast shade of Corn Flower Blue. #6B8EEC RGB value is rgb(107, 142, 236). RGB Color Model of #6B8EEC consists of 41% red, 55% green and 92% blue. HSL color Mode of #6B8EEC has 224°(degrees) Hue, 77% Saturation and 67% Lightness. #6B8EEC color has an wavelength of 478.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#6B8EEC is #9999F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#6B8EEC is #68E. The Closest Color to #6B8EEC is #6495ED. Official Name of #6B8EEC Hex Code is Cornflower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#6B8EEC is 55 Cyan 40 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#6B8EEC CMY is 55, 40,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#6B8EEC is hsl(224,77,67,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(224, 55,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#6B8EEC is 30.87, 28.53, 83.22.
Hex8 Value of #6B8EEC is #6B8EECFF. Decimal Value of #6B8EEC is 7048940 and Octal Value of #6B8EEC is 32707354. Binary Value of #6B8EEC is 1101011, 10001110, 11101100 and Android of #6B8EEC is 4285239020 / 0xff6b8eec.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#6B8EEC is 0.216, 0.2, 0.2 and YIQ Color Space of #6B8EEC is 142.251, -51.0587, 21.8503.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#6B8EEC is 21.36, 27.22, 82.32.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#6B8EEC is 60.36, 14.53, -51.2.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#6B8EEC is 60.36, -18.48, -83.13.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#6B8EEC is 60.36, 53.22, 285.84. Hunter Lab variable of #6B8EEC is 53.41, 9.69, -54.99.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#6B8EEC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
